Polestar 3 Launches Affordable RWD Model with 350-Mile Range
The new single-motor variant of the Polestar 3 SUV offers a longer range and qualifies for the federal EV tax credit due to its US manufacturing.
- The Polestar 3 Long Range Single Motor starts at $67,500, making it the most affordable option in the lineup.
- The RWD model boasts an EPA-estimated range of 350 miles, surpassing the dual-motor version's 315 miles.
- Manufactured in South Carolina, the Polestar 3 qualifies for the $7,500 federal tax credit under current regulations.
- The new variant features a 111 kWh battery, 295 hp, and a 0-60 mph acceleration time of 7.5 seconds.
- All Polestar 3 models come standard with the Pilot Pack, offering advanced driver-assistance features.
